Frontline Consulting lines up $20 million for Hyd

Frontline Consulting Services (Private) Limited, the research and delivery arm of US-based IT solutions and products provider FCS Inc, is planning to invest $20 million (approximately Rs 90 crore) in Hyderabad in the next three years, according to FCS country head Sreenivasa Hosamane.

“We have been allotted land in the Kokapet Empire Site special economic zone, where we plan to develop an integrated campus to accommodate about 1,500 employees, which is targeted for 2013,” he said.

FCS has grown aggressively in Hyderabad since it began operations in 2008 with over 300 employees working from its Hitec City office. It has invested $5 million (Rs 22.5 crore) in purchasing and developing its own office facility. The new facility, expanded to 20,000-sft, was inaugurated by Assembly speaker N Kiran Kumar Reddy on Sunday.

“We have strategically aligned ourselves with Oracle Corporation partnering at various levels as Oracle platinum partner, business intelligence pillar initiative partner, development alliance partner and also Oracle on-demand partner. This has resulted in innovative product solutions like Demand Signal Repository (www.retailsignal.com), manufacturing analytics for the retail and manufacturing sector,” Vikas Handa, chief executive of FCS stated in a press release.
